Description

  • Assist with full-cycle accounting operations including accounts payable, accounts receivable, and general ledger maintenance under supervision
  • Support month-end and year-end closing procedures with guidance from senior team members
  • Prepare and maintain accurate financial documentation in compliance with IFRS/PFRS standards
  • Assist with payroll processing and benefits administration using established systems
  • Support tax compliance activities and regulatory filing preparation
  • Help maintain and reconcile bank accounts and financial accounts with oversight
  • Process vendor payments and support cash flow management activities
  • Utilize Excel and QuickBooks Online to maintain accurate financial records
  • Support administrative functions including contract management and office operations
  • Collaborate with team members to understand business requirements and learn financial processes
  • Document accounting procedures and assist in establishing internal controls
  • Participate in audit preparation and support external auditor interactions

Minimum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or related field (recent graduate or within 1 year of graduation)
  • Less than 1 year of relevant accounting experience or strong academic background in accounting
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Excel (intermediate level) and willingness to learn QuickBooks Online
  • Basic understanding of IFRS/PFRS principles and financial reporting
  • Knowledge of fundamental accounting concepts and practices
  • Strong attention to detail and commitment to accuracy
  • Ability to work in a team environment and follow established procedures

Preferred Qualifications

  • Internship experience in accounting or finance
  • Familiarity with accounting software platforms
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ills
  • Excellent communication skills with ability to ask clarifying questions
  • Proactive attitude with willingness to learn and grow
  • Experience with payroll systems or benefits administration
  • CPA exam preparation or enrollment in CPA program
